Population: density and quick facts
| Metric | Bland County | Virginia Avg | U.S. Average |
|---|---|---|---|
| Population | 6,197 | 8,661,529 | 334,821,731 |
| Population density (per sq mi) | 17.3 | 202.3 | 85.8 |
| Population growth (%/yr) | -0.91% | 0.60% | 0.57% |
| Median age | 46.6 | 37.2 | 37.1 |
| Households | 2,345 | 3,324,966 | 128,459,983 |
Population in Bland County declined by 8.6% from 2009 to 2023, reaching 6,211 in 2023.

Economy
Bland County has a the economy index of D, which means it is barely prosperous.
| Metric | Bland County | Virginia Avg | U.S. Average |
|---|---|---|---|
| Median household income | $63,201 | $91,409 | $78,145 |
| Income growth (%/yr) | 4.41% | 4.62% | 5.07% |
| Unemployment rate | 1.7% | 4.2% | 5.2% |
The median household income in Bland County is about 31% lower than in Virginia.
Housing
| Metric | Bland County | Virginia Avg | U.S. Average |
|---|---|---|---|
| Median home price | $186,250 | $257,048 | $242,182 |
| Median rent | $682 | $1,514 | $1,342 |
| Homeownership rate | 80.9% | 67.2% | 65.1% |
The median home price in Bland County is about 22.7 years' worth of rent — buying at the median price costs roughly as much as paying the median rent of $682 per month for that long.
Commute Time & Mobility
Commuters in Bland County spend about 46 minutes on the road round trip each working day. Over a typical 250-day work year, that adds up to roughly 191 hours, about 8.0 full days, spent commuting.
| Metric | Bland County | Virginia Avg | U.S. Average |
|---|---|---|---|
| One-way commute (min) | 22.9 | 23.3 | 22.5 |
| Round-trip commute (min) | 45.8 | 46.5 | 44.9 |
| Yearly time spent (hours) | 191 | 194 | 187 |
| Estimated yearly cost | $5,921 | $6,010 | $5,803 |
| Work from home | 5.2% | 16.2% | 13.4% |
| Highway traffic (vehicles/day) | 8,222 | 10,059 | 8,813 |
| Local road traffic (vehicles/day) | 709 | 1,531 | 1,355 |
Fastest commutes among counties in
Virginia:
Lexington city (8.7 min), Norton city (11.5 min), Covington city (11.8 min).
Slowest:
Surry County (43.2 min), Amelia County (40.4 min), Buckingham County (38.3 min).
The average commute time in Bland County is about the same as in Virginia.
Estimated yearly cost applies a single national wage rule of thumb (U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ics average hourly earnings), not a measurement of wages in this area. Traffic volume figures come from proprietary Ticon and TrafficZoom data.

Health
Bland County has a health index of B, which means it is quite healthy.
| Metric | Bland County | Virginia Avg | U.S. Average |
|---|---|---|---|
| Life expectancy (years) | 74.8 | 77.3 | 78.3 |
| Self-rated poor health | 15.8% | 16.9% | 16.3% |
| Smokers | 20.6% | 19.0% | 19.0% |
